The Netherlands
Known to the Dutch as our āLittle Frog Landā. The Netherlands is the place that feels like home for me and is where I grew up. Itās a tiny country with strong opinions, some great humor and some great museums and artists that revolutionized and are known around the world. It is also a place where it rains a lot and is so flat you can see into the distance miles away. In my home is where I learned about art, and was the start of this obsession with beautiful objects telling me stories.